The phoenix is a sacred regenerating mythical firebird, that is known to rise from its ashes over and over again. Most legends stat that the phoenix dies by fire, and only one phoenix can be alive at a time, though some interpret it differently. The phoenix's feather colors vary, but it's tail is said to be of gold and scarlet, or also purple, green, and blue. It is typically the size of an eagle, but many myths and legends have different sizes for the phoenix. The phoenix lives for around 500-1000 years, until at the end of it's life cycle, it builds itself a cinnamon twig nest and sets itself, and the nest, ablaze. Once the nest and phoenix turn to ashes, a new, young phoenix rises from those ashes to start a new life. 

Legend says that a phoenix's cry sounds like a beautiful song. Few legends stat that a phoenix can change into people, and some say that the phoenix is immortal. Phoenix's are known to feed off of frankincense and odoriferous gums.
